First thing you can’t hold your final pay check as per labour law F&F should be made within 45days if not you can pull them to court.
Second thing relieving letter should be provided within 2weeks of max nowadays they are giving it in 3-4days.
With respect to work pressure you can openly say that you have resigned because of the workload and still assigning overload ! Also you can ensure you are not extending your work hours no matter what.

If you are actually in notice period, you mostly not required to work on huge tasks rather inform them about your notice period.
Notice period generally came in picture that employee can train other person who will be replacing you not for overload work in last moment.
You can politely refuse the work and can guide other person to work and it won't effect in final paycheck and relieving letter.
